Метод извлечения к уже существующему интерфейсу с ReSharper


Я добавляю новый метод в класс, который реализует интерфейс, и мне нравится использовать рефакторинг "Extract Interface" и просто добавить метод в интерфейс. Но не похоже, что ReSharper поддерживает добавление подписи метода к уже существующему интерфейсу.

такое чувство, что я что-то упускаю, я уверен, что это можно сделать как-то. Может быть, я должен сначала добавить сигнатуру метода в интерфейс, но это то, как я иногда работаю. Я пропустил какой-то ярлык, особенность или использование ReSharper неправильно?

1 84

1 ответ:

Ctrl+Shift+R для доступа к меню рефакторинга выберите Члены Подтянуть...

вы можете выбрать интерфейс, в который вы хотите добавить объявления, а также выбрать каждый метод, который вы хотите добавить в интерфейс.

должен любить Resharper! ; -)